Social and Emotional Learning (SEL) is a crucial component of a child’s education that many schools are beginning to prioritize SEL teaches students how to manage their emotions, resolve conflicts, set and achieve goals, and make responsible decisions By incorporating SEL into the curriculum, elementary schools can help students develop the skills they need to succeed academically, emotionally, and socially In this article, we will explore the benefits of SEL in elementary schools and why it is essential for the overall well-being of students.
One of the primary benefits of SEL in elementary schools is the positive impact it has on academic performance Research has shown that students who participate in SEL programs have higher achievement levels, improved attitudes towards school, and better classroom behavior By teaching students how to regulate their emotions and practice empathy towards others, schools create a positive learning environment that fosters academic success When students feel safe, supported, and respected, they are more likely to engage in learning and take risks in their academic pursuits.
Furthermore, SEL helps students develop essential life skills that extend beyond the classroom By learning how to manage their emotions, communicate effectively, and work well with others, students are better equipped to navigate the challenges of adolescence and adulthood SEL teaches important skills such as self-awareness, self-management, social awareness, relationship skills, and responsible decision-making These skills are not only valuable for academic success but also for developing healthy relationships, making ethical choices, and coping with stress and adversity.

Another key benefit of SEL in elementary schools is the promotion of positive behavior and a positive school climate When students have strong social and emotional skills, they are better equipped to handle conflicts, communicate effectively, and engage in positive interactions with their peers and teachers This leads to a decrease in bullying, aggression, and other negative behaviors that can disrupt the learning environment By teaching students how to understand and manage their emotions, schools create a culture of respect, kindness, and empathy that benefits everyone in the school community.
SEL is also beneficial for building strong relationships between students and teachers When educators prioritize SEL and model positive social and emotional skills, they create a trusting and supportive relationship with their students This leads to increased student engagement, motivation, and academic achievement By incorporating SEL into their teaching practices, teachers can help students feel valued, understood, and supported, which enhances their overall well-being and success in school.
